Bio
Matt Prysock begins his second season as an assistant coach on the Baton Rouge Community College softball coaching staff. In this role, Coach Prysock will handle day-to-day administrative duties and will work closely with Head Coach Bolton to support the development and growth of the Bears softball student-athletes.
Originally from Benton, Arkansas, Matt graduated from Centenary College in Shreveport, Louisiana, with degrees in Health and Exercise Science and Business Administration. While in college, he played baseball. After graduating, he served as the Assistant Softball Coach at Ranger Junior College in Ranger, Texas, where he also acted as the head Women's Basketball Coach, leading the team to its first winning season in over a decade.
Matt returned to Centenary College, where he worked as an assistant coach for the NCAA Division I Centenary Softball Team under Coach Michael Bastian. At the young age of 22, he became the head coach, making him the youngest NCAA Division I college coach across all sports at that time. Following his time at Centenary, Coach Prysock transitioned to the University of Central Arkansas as an assistant coach before starting a corporate career with Allergan Medical in Dallas.
During his tenure in Texas, he held marketing positions with notable sports teams such as the NBA's Dallas Mavericks, the NHL's Dallas Stars, and the MLS's Dallas Burn (now FC Dallas). Additionally, he contributed as a volunteer at Baylor University.
After his time with Allergan Medical, Coach Prysock returned to the softball coaching world, serving as the assistant coach at the University of Rich Mountain during the 2024 season. He was named the Head Coach of Southeast Arkansas College in July 2024, but unfortunately, the program could not complete the full 2025 season due to injuries that limited their roster size.
